Output bf63e3882658b9ca2784cf87a9f804f87c0836a592d8c80462403ea53399d715:0

value
308998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72a0972f5b0cfaa183672b660bcd99a498ee6659 OP_EQUAL
address
3C97LSWNwwr13yU6Pd26VuKNRbbbLiK6zW
transaction
bf63e3882658b9ca2784cf87a9f804f87c0836a592d8c80462403ea53399d715